Treasure Island screenshot - click to enlargeThis Match-3 game is a dream come true. You see, I'm what you might call Match-3 challenged. Treasure Island is tailor-made for someone like me.

The game is designed for maximum enjoyment without any of that bothersome frustration that tends to lurk within the genre. Praise you, Nevosoft!

Basically, players follow a map to locate hidden treasure. In Classic Mode, the game is so forgiving that if a level is too punishing, you have the option of skipping it after a couple of tries. This feature insures that you never get hung up anywhere. Oh yeah.

Even if you manage to do yourself in, you can re-enter the game and pick things up right where you left them without having to start completely over. What a relief.

Treasure Island screenshot - click to enlargeAnd then there's Timeless Mode, where you can play as long as you like and never die. Hallelujah!

For me, these things made Treasure Island infinitely enjoyable -- but I haven't even gotten to the best part yet! After each completed level, you're treated to an assortment of totally outrageous dancing skeletons. Words can't do them justice -- you should download this game and see for yourself. They're absolutely priceless!

So yar, ye mateys, and listen up (here comes some corn, but I have to say it): Treasure Island is yo-ho-ho and a barrel of fun!!
